TYRES This vehicle is equipped with tubeless tyres.

Have a tyre changed when worn or punctured, if the puncture in the tread is larger than 5 mm. Have the wheels balanced after each tyre repair.

NOTE

Halve maintenance intervals if you are riding in rainy or dusty conditions, on rough road surfaces or when the vehicle is used in competitions.

WARNING

WARNING Check the inflation pressure at ambient temperature every two weeks. Every 1000 km (625 mi) check tires for wear and check their inflating pressure at ambient temperature, see page 90 (TECHNICAL DATA). Measuring pressure on hot tyres will lead to inaccurate measurement. It is especially important to measure tyre pressure before and after a long trip. Over-inflated tyres will not absorb bumps when riding on rough road surfaces and resulting vibration is transferred through the handlebar, giving a hard ride and reducing tyre grip especially during cornering. Conversely, under-inflation will put more stress on the sidewalls (1) and the tyre may slip on the rim or even come off the rim, leading to loss of control.

The tyres could come off the rims under hard braking. Finally, the vehicle could skid during cornering.

WARNING Inspect tyre surface condition and check for wear, as worn tyres lead to poor road holding and handling. Some of the tyres approved for this vehicle are equipped with wear indicators. There are several kinds of wear indicators. For more information on how to check the tyres for wear, contact your Dealer. Visually inspect the tyres for wear and have them changed if worn.

Spare tyres should be of the recommended type and model, see page 90 (TECHNICAL DATA); using different tyres then the specified ones negatively affects vehicle handling. Do not install tube tyres on tubeless tyre rims or vice versa. Make sure that caps are in place on the valves (2), or the tyres may deflate suddenly. Tyre replacement and repair, and wheel servicing and balancing are delicate operations that should be carried out using adequate tools and are best left to experienced mechanics. For this reason, it is advisable to have these operations carried out by a Moto Guzzi Authorised Dealer or by a qualified tyre repairer.
